Method 1: Using Folders (No Password, But Effective Organization)

While not strictly "hiding" apps with a password, organizing apps into folders provides a significant level of visual privacy. Simply drag and drop apps onto each other to create a folder. This isn't password-protected, but it does a good job of keeping things tidy and less obvious.

Steps:

  1. Locate the app: Find the app you want to hide on your home screen.
  2. Drag and drop: Press and hold the app icon until it jiggles. Drag it onto another app icon to create a folder.
  3. Name your folder: Rename the folder to something discreet.

Method 3: Screen Time (Built-in iOS Feature for Parental Control)

If you're looking to restrict access for children or others using your device, Apple's built-in Screen Time feature offers a robust solution. While not strictly hiding apps, it can limit their usage and even require a passcode to access specific apps.

Steps:

  1. Navigate to Screen Time: Open the Settings app and tap on "Screen Time."
  2. App Limits: Tap "App Limits" and select the apps you want to restrict.
  3. Set Time Limits: Set a daily time limit for each app.
  4. Passcode Protection (Crucial): Set a Screen Time passcode to prevent changes to the restrictions.
